# Mail Room Relocation — Access Notes for Contractors

The mail room at Dunmere Court has moved from Ground Floor East to Basement Level 1, next to the goods lift. Visiting contractors making deliveries must sign in at the service entrance and proceed via Corridor B only. The new mail room door is keypad-controlled; contractors on the approved list should enter the access code provided below.

turnstile pass: bdg-QZV-3

## Stockmend Reconciliation Job — Scheduling

The nightly reconciliation job compares Wareline counts against the Fenwick ledger and emits deltas to the adjustments queue. It runs after the last depot sync for the Calverton region closes. Retries are bounded; anything unresolved after the final pass is flagged for manual review, not re-queued. Release gating: the job must complete under 40 minutes on staging before promotion. Batch size, retry backoff, and queue limits are tunable. The current tuning constants are listed below.

tuning constants:
QUOTAS = {
    "druwyn": 5,
    "holix": 5,
    "zorath": 5,
    "holwyn": 10,
}

# Env for the Nightglass backfill scheduler.
# This file is loaded only by the nightly cron runner; it is never
# mounted into user-facing pods. Review rotation cadence quarterly.
# Scope: read-only access to the warehouse replica, write to staging
# tables only. The scheduler's warehouse credential is set on the
# line immediately below.

vault entry, yahif-yajep: COURIER_KEY29=b802bdf8034096b65a51c6ba5abe2

Across the Brellan and Oskett portfolios, average concessions reached 18.4%, exceeding the 15% ceiling approved last year. The variance stems largely from bundled renewals negotiated by regional teams without central sign-off. We recommend reinstating mandatory review by the Pricing Council for any contract exceeding the threshold, with quarterly audits of exceptions. A revised approval matrix will circulate next month. Before then, please note the following confidential guidance on forward plans.

board note of kageg-bahof: The renewal with Holwynax Holdings closes at $2 million a year, 5 percent below the last contract. Project Ulaath slips by two quarters because of the supplier delay.